Description
3-Ethyl-2,5-pyrazinediethanol, also known as Clavulanate Potassium EP Impurity C, is a chemical compound derived from Clavulanic acid (C563750). It is an impurity found in the production process of Clavulanic acid, which is a β-lactamase inhibitor used in combination with penicillin antibiotics to enhance their effectiveness.
